Biography

Servicenumber C.63438.

After enlisting in the Canadian Army, Gordon Cecil Crozier was send overseas to Europe on February 15th, 1941. He fought in Normandy and the Netherlands.

After the Second World War, Crozier stayed in the Canadian Army and served with the United Nations Emergency Force Ordnance Company at Camp Rafah, Egypt for which he received the United Nations Medal. He retired in 1970. In 1991 he died after a farming accident.
